NBU 168E is a 1999 Kawasaki GPX600R in Black with a 592c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 6 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 100%.
The most common reason a Kawasaki GPX600R fails its MOT is shock absorber seal failed and leaking oil, accounting for 141 recorded failures. If you're considering buying NBU 168E,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Kawasaki GPX600R typically stays on UK roads for around 38 years. At 27 years old, this Kawasaki GPX600R is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
